Demonstrations against mosque in Göteborg

21 May 2011

Protests against a new mosque in Göteborg attracted approximately 150 nationalist and far right wing protesters, and maybe 300 people supporting the mosque. Amongst the initiators of the demonstration against the mosque was Björn Cederström of the newly started Defense Corps for Sweden’s Self-defense. In his speech at the rally he said Muslims force native Swedes to flee their own country and that we must prepare for civil war. Marc Abrahamsson of the National Democrats said Sweden is being occupied by Arabs and Muslims.

There were also representatives from the English Defense League present, while the Swedish Defense League was not allowed to participate as Cederström regards them as being “too Zionistic”.

The demonstrations resulted in quite a rumble and four persons were arrested by the police.
